Developing Economies vs. New Markets: Understanding the Gap
While both developing economies and frontier economies offer promise for businesses, it's important to appreciate the significant variations. Emerging markets, like China, have already undergone substantial financial expansion and inclusion into the global landscape. However, frontier economies – think Vietnam – encompass lesser stages of development, defined by lower income, lesser mature financial structures, and typically increased political risk. Therefore, while frontier economies may provide the prospect for exceptionally high profits, they also involve appreciably more hazard than operating in emerging regions.
